Discrete Mathematics

study guides for every class

that actually explain what's on your next test

Key Management

from class:

Discrete Mathematics

Definition

Key management refers to the processes and systems involved in managing cryptographic keys for secure communication and data protection. It ensures that keys are generated, distributed, stored, and retired securely throughout their lifecycle, which is vital for maintaining the integrity and confidentiality of data encrypted using public key cryptography. Effective key management is crucial to prevent unauthorized access and to maintain trust in digital communications.

congrats on reading the definition of Key Management.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Key management encompasses key generation, distribution, storage, rotation, and revocation to ensure the security of cryptographic keys.
  2. In public key cryptography, each user has a pair of keys: a public key for encryption and a private key for decryption, making key management essential for secure communication.
  3. Secure storage of keys is vital; compromised keys can lead to unauthorized access to sensitive data.
  4. Key lifecycle management includes defining policies for how keys are handled from creation through retirement.
  5. Automated key management solutions can significantly reduce the risk of human error and enhance the overall security posture.

Review Questions

  • How does effective key management contribute to the security of public key cryptography?
    • Effective key management is critical for public key cryptography as it ensures that keys are properly generated, distributed, and maintained throughout their lifecycle. Without robust key management practices, the security of the encrypted communications would be compromised since weak or mishandled keys could lead to unauthorized access. By securely managing both the public and private keys, users can maintain confidentiality and trust in their digital interactions.
  • Analyze the role of Public Key Infrastructure (PKI) in enhancing key management processes.
    • Public Key Infrastructure (PKI) plays a vital role in enhancing key management by providing a comprehensive framework for issuing, managing, and revoking digital certificates that link public keys to identities. PKI establishes trust through Certificate Authorities (CAs), which validate identities before issuing certificates. This structured approach allows organizations to implement secure protocols for key distribution and lifecycle management, thereby strengthening overall security in public key cryptography.
  • Evaluate the potential risks associated with poor key management practices in the context of digital security.
    • Poor key management practices can lead to significant risks such as unauthorized access to sensitive information, data breaches, and loss of trust in digital communications. When cryptographic keys are not securely stored or properly handled throughout their lifecycle, attackers can exploit these vulnerabilities to decrypt sensitive data or impersonate legitimate users. Additionally, ineffective key rotation and revocation policies can leave outdated keys active longer than necessary, increasing the risk of exploitation and undermining the integrity of secure systems.
©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.
Glossary
Guides